The cheapest way to get from Girvan to Erskine is to drive which costs £14 - £22 and takes 1h 11m.
The fastest way to get from Girvan to Erskine is to drive which takes 1h 11m and costs £14 - £22.
No, there is no direct bus from Girvan to Erskine. However, there are services departing from High Street and arriving at Park Moor via Ayr Bus Station and West Campbell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 14m.
The distance between Girvan and Erskine is 64 miles. The road distance is 61.3 miles.
The best way to get from Girvan to Erskine without a car is to train and line 757 bus which takes 2h 9m and costs £30 - £55.
It takes approximately 2h 9m to get from Girvan to Erskine, including transfers.
Girvan to Erskine bus services, operated by Stagecoach West Scotland, depart from High Street station.
Girvan to Erskine bus services, operated by Stagecoach West Scotland, arrive at Ayr Bus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Girvan to Erskine is 61 miles. It takes approximately 1h 11m to drive from Girvan to Erskine.
